[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]My understanding is that the COSA office/staff make these decisions and the related Principals (outgoing and incoming schools) are told the decisions. I don't believe that the Principals are as involved in the decision making as this thread makes them seem to be.[/quote] Your understanding is incorrect. I am a teacher at a school that receives many, many COSA requests--the principal at my workplace makes a concerted effort to "keep it equal," meaning only accepting as many transfers in as we have going out to other schools. I assume the principals can be overruled by higher-ups in some situations, but they are definitely involved in the process. [/quote]
